1/2"-13 Hex Die Bmx - Vermont American

Part #: 20876

The Vermont American 20876 1/2"-13 Hex Die Bmx is engineered for precision threading in demanding professional environments. Constructed from robust, heat-treated steel, this hex die is designed to create or repair external threads with consistent accuracy. It serves as a reliable tool for technicians and mechanics requiring durable equipment for various threading tasks.

Key Features

  • Durable Steel Construction: Manufactured from high-grade steel, ensuring resilience and extended tool life under regular professional use.
  • Heat-Treated for Strength: Specifically heat-treated to enhance its structural integrity and resistance to wear, making it suitable for tough threading applications.
  • Precision Ground: Each die is precision ground to deliver accurate thread pitches and clean cuts, crucial for proper fastener fit and function.
  • Black Oxide Finish: Features a black oxide coating that provides a layer of protection against corrosion and rust, maintaining the die's performance over time.
  • ANSI Compliant: Designed and manufactured to meet or exceed ANSI standards, ensuring a consistent level of quality and performance.

Applications

This Vermont American hex die is suitable for a wide range of professional applications where reliable thread creation and repair are necessary.

  • Automotive Repair: Ideal for rethreading damaged studs, bolts, and shafts on vehicles, facilitating component assembly and maintenance.
  • Industrial Maintenance: Used in manufacturing and maintenance settings for creating new threads on metal rods or repairing existing ones on machinery and equipment.
  • Construction: Applicable for threading various components on-site, such as anchor bolts or custom fasteners, to meet specific project requirements.
